The Evolution of Steel Files with An Exporter Perspective


Steel files have long been an essential tool in various industries, from metalworking to woodworking, and even in the realm of jewelry making. These manual tools come in various shapes and sizes, allowing craftsmen to refine, shape, and smooth surfaces with precision. The evolution of steel files, alongside the rise of exporters in the industry, has transformed not only the manufacturing process but also international trade and market accessibility.


Historically, the creation of steel files can be traced back to ancient civilizations, where artisans required robust tools to form and finish metal components. The pivotal advancement came during the Industrial Revolution when the demand for high-quality files soared. Manufacturers began to adopt mass production techniques, leading to better consistency in tool quality and performance. Nonetheless, the fundamental design of steel files remained largely unchanged, focused as it was on functionality and durability.


Today, producers of steel files utilize advanced metallurgy and manufacturing processes to enhance the quality and longevity of their tools. The availability of specialized steels allows for the creation of files that can withstand heavy use while maintaining their cutting capabilities. Modern technology, such as computer numerical control (CNC) machining and laser heat treatment, has streamlined production, ensuring precision and uniformity across batches.


From an exporter’s perspective, the global market for steel files is increasingly interconnected. Countries with strong manufacturing bases, such as China, Germany, and the United States, dominate the production landscape. These nations not only supply local markets but also export their tools worldwide, establishing a competitive international trade scenario. Exporters play a crucial role in this ecosystem, facilitating the movement of products from manufacturers to retailers and ultimately to consumers.

One of the key factors fueling demand for steel files is the growth of the DIY culture and the rise of small-scale manufacturing. As more people take on personal projects, whether for hobbies or home improvement, the need for reliable tools has increased. Consequently, exporters are adapting by providing a diverse range of steel files tailored to various applications, ensuring that both professionals and amateurs have access to suitable options.


Environmental considerations are also shaping the direction of the steel file industry and its exporters. As global awareness of sustainability rises, manufacturers are increasingly focusing on eco-friendly practices. This includes sourcing raw materials responsibly and exploring methods to reduce waste during production. Exporters are key players in this shift, as they now often demand compliance with environmental regulations and certifications from manufacturers.


In terms of market distribution, technology has opened new avenues for exporters. E-commerce platforms have made it easier for manufacturers and exporters to reach international customers directly. By leveraging online marketplaces, they can showcase a diverse range of products, including specialty files designed for niche markets such as dental technology, medical equipment fabrication, and automotive restoration.


Additionally, partnerships between exporters and local distributors can enhance product accessibility in emerging markets. These collaborations can facilitate efficient logistics and distribution networks, ensuring that high-quality steel files reach consumers in regions that were previously underserved.


In conclusion, the evolution of steel files reflects not only advancements in material science and manufacturing but also the dynamic nature of international trade. Exporters serve as vital links in the supply chain, connecting manufacturers with global markets and fostering the accessibility of these essential tools. As industries continue to evolve and adapt to new demands, the role of steel files will undoubtedly remain indispensable, reinforcing the need for innovation and adaptability among producers and exporters alike. With a growing focus on sustainability and technology-driven solutions, the future of steel files is poised for continued growth and transformation.
